Every other day of my life I get at least one application for a credit card. Capital One is one of the worst offenders, so I happily send the business reply envelopes back to them. The only catch is I don't send the application back, I send other stuff.

11/25/2000 - Two more! I put a slice of cheese into one of them, and filled the other with 5 shreded credit card applications.

11/2/2000 - I saved up 6 envelopes, and am sending a new batch of stuff out:
Two of them contain an M&M minis wrapper.
One contains three packets of soy sauce.
One has a sticky note that says "Prof. Cruz" on it
Another has my clipped toe-nails ... yuck!
And the last has every scrap of paper that was on my table
I wonder what these people think when they get this stuff?


So I started to have fun and sent back:
The application ripped up
Toenail Clippings!
Nothing (empty envelope)

And then someone told me that they have to pay the postage on whatever is sent back, so I decided to step up the effort. I sent:
Pennies - $1.40 worth
Circuit Boards - Being the computer geek I am, I have countless worthless circuit boards laying around my apartment. If they don't fit in the envelope, I fold them!
